What Is a Fall Protection Harness and Why Is It Essential?
A fall protection harness is a critical piece of safety equipment designed to prevent workers from falling from heights during construction, maintenance, or other elevated work activities. It consists of a series of straps that distribute the force of a fall across the body, typically secured at points on the shoulders, chest, and legs, and is often connected to a fall arrest system that includes anchors and lanyards.
According to the Occupational Safety and Health Administration (OSHA), falls are one of the leading causes of fatalities in the construction industry, accounting for approximately 34% of total worker deaths in 2020. The use of fall protection harnesses is mandated in many work environments where heights pose a risk, underscoring their importance in occupational safety.
Key aspects of a fall protection harness include its design, which must comply with safety standards such as those set by the American National Standards Institute (ANSI) and the International Safety Equipment Association (ISEA). Harnesses typically feature adjustable straps to ensure a secure fit, D-rings for attaching lanyards, and padding for comfort during extended use. Additionally, they come in various types suited for different applications, such as full-body harnesses for general use or specialized harnesses for specific tasks like tower climbing or rescue operations.

What Key Features Should You Look for in a Fall Protection Harness?
When searching for the best fall protection harness, consider the following key features:
- Adjustability: A good harness should have multiple adjustment points to ensure a secure and comfortable fit for various body types. This feature helps prevent movement during use and ensures the harness distributes weight evenly during a fall.
- Weight Capacity: Check the weight capacity specified by the manufacturer to ensure it can safely support the user and any additional gear. This is crucial for compliance with safety standards and to protect the user in case of a fall.
- Material Durability: The materials used in the harness should be both strong and lightweight, often made from polyester or nylon. Durable materials are essential to withstand harsh working conditions and provide long-term reliability.
- Padding: Look for harnesses with adequate padding in the shoulder, back, and leg areas for enhanced comfort during prolonged use. Proper padding prevents chafing and discomfort, allowing the user to focus on their work without distraction.
- Attachment Points: Ensure the harness has multiple D-rings or attachment points for connecting to lanyards and other fall protection systems. Properly placed attachment points facilitate a range of movements and allow for safe and effective use in various work environments.
- Compliance with Standards: Check that the harness meets safety standards such as ANSI Z359 or OSHA regulations. Compliance ensures that the harness has been rigorously tested for safety and reliability in fall protection applications.
- Ease of Use: A user-friendly design is crucial for quick donning and doffing of the harness, especially in emergency situations. Features like quick-release buckles and color-coded straps can simplify the process and enhance overall safety.
- Breathability: Harnesses with breathable fabrics or mesh panels can help regulate body temperature during hot working conditions. This feature improves comfort and reduces fatigue, making it easier to wear the harness for extended periods.
What Types of Fall Protection Harnesses Are There?
The main types of fall protection harnesses include:
- Full-Body Harness: A full-body harness is designed to distribute the force of a fall across the body, providing support and safety in various work environments.
- Chest Harness: A chest harness secures the upper body and is often used in combination with other harnesses for added safety during specific tasks.
- Seat Harness: Typically used in climbing and rescue operations, a seat harness is designed to support the lower body and provide comfort during prolonged suspension.
- Rescue Harness: A rescue harness is specifically designed for emergency situations, allowing for quick and safe retrieval of personnel from heights.
- Specialty Harness: These harnesses cater to specific industries or tasks, such as construction or telecommunications, offering unique features tailored to particular safety requirements.
A full-body harness is the most common type used in fall protection as it provides comprehensive support. It includes multiple adjustment points to fit various body shapes and sizes, ensuring comfort and safety during prolonged wear. The harness features attachment points for lanyards or lifelines, enabling workers to secure themselves effectively while working at heights.
A chest harness is primarily focused on securing the upper torso and is often used in specialized scenarios, such as when working in confined spaces or performing rescues. While it can be worn independently, it is frequently used in combination with a full-body harness to provide enhanced safety and fall protection.
A seat harness is particularly popular among climbers and rescue professionals because it allows for comfort during extended periods of suspension. Its design typically includes a padded seat and leg straps, which help distribute weight evenly, reducing strain on the legs and back while maintaining the user’s freedom of movement.
A rescue harness is crucial in emergency response situations, as it allows for swift evacuation of individuals from precarious heights. It is designed to facilitate quick attachment and detachment, often featuring a quick-release mechanism to expedite rescue efforts without compromising safety.
Specialty harnesses are tailored for specific occupations and environments, such as electrical work or industrial maintenance. These harnesses may include features like additional D-rings for tool attachments, reflective materials for visibility, or enhanced padding for comfort, catering to the unique demands of various fields.

How Do You Properly Fit a Fall Protection Harness?
Properly fitting a fall protection harness is essential for ensuring safety while working at heights.
- Adjust the Shoulder Straps: The shoulder straps should be adjusted to fit snugly but comfortably over your shoulders. This prevents slipping during use, ensuring the harness stays in place and distributes weight evenly across your body.
- Adjust the Leg Straps: The leg straps need to be tightened so that they are secure but not overly tight, allowing for movement and comfort. A good fitting leg strap should allow you to fit two fingers between the strap and your leg, ensuring that it is secure without causing discomfort.
- Fasten the Chest Strap: The chest strap should be positioned at the mid-chest level to provide stability and support. It should also be snug enough to prevent the shoulder straps from sliding off your shoulders while still allowing for free movement of your arms.
- Check the D-Ring Position: The D-ring, which is used for connecting to a lanyard, should be located between the shoulder blades. This positioning helps in distributing forces during a fall and ensures that the harness performs correctly under stress.
- Perform a Final Safety Check: After adjusting all straps, it is important to do a final check to ensure that nothing is twisted or out of place. Make sure all buckles are securely fastened and that the harness feels comfortable yet secure during movements.

How Can You Ensure the Longevity of Your Fall Protection Harness?
To ensure the longevity of your fall protection harness, consider the following best practices:
- Regular Inspection: Conduct routine inspections of your harness for any signs of wear, damage, or deterioration.
- Proper Cleaning: Clean your harness according to the manufacturer’s instructions to remove dirt, sweat, and contaminants.
- Correct Storage: Store your harness in a cool, dry place away from direct sunlight and harsh chemicals.
- Follow Manufacturer Guidelines: Adhere strictly to the manufacturer’s guidelines regarding usage limits and maintenance.
- Training and Usage: Ensure that all users are properly trained in how to wear and utilize the harness correctly.
Regular inspections are essential for identifying any potential issues before they become serious problems. Check for frayed straps, broken buckles, or other signs of wear that could compromise safety. Document these inspections to maintain a history of the harness’s condition.
Proper cleaning involves using mild soap and water, avoiding harsh chemicals that can degrade materials. After cleaning, allow the harness to air dry completely before storage to prevent mildew or odors from developing.
Correct storage is crucial; keep your harness in a designated area where it won’t be exposed to extreme temperatures or moisture. Avoid hanging it in direct sunlight for prolonged periods, as UV rays can weaken the materials over time.
Following manufacturer guidelines is vital, as each harness may have specific recommendations regarding lifespan, loading limits, and maintenance procedures. Ignoring these guidelines can lead to premature failure of the harness.
Training and proper usage ensure that the harness is fitted correctly and used in accordance with safety standards. Regular training sessions can help reinforce proper techniques and identify any changes in safety protocols.
